My lament over inventory is if inventory was so high (it is) why the lack of product? Other lps have inventory that more closely matched their sales. I have been financing commercial businesses for more than 20 years and everytime I encountered a company with inventory levels even twice their sales they either had cash flow issues or needed to inject capital (or spend their capital) to keep things afloat....I don't buy into growing weed u can't currently sell....and if u care to do any dd, go back to when inventory levels jumped significantly (aprox late 2015) and you will find it was pre DNA strains which were not the best (hence seeking dna's help). Ask your self where did this poor quality weed go? I think it was stashed in the vault as opposed to destroyed (ie written off). It's well known they had trouble growing quality weed in the early going....no gmp production platform currently in place which will only increase their operating cost once they are forced to adapt that level of production standard (it's demanded in the pharmaceutical space). So to sum up, questionable inventory, lack of required production standard to participate in pharmacy distribution, and a shotgun approach to business plan really turns me off
